Bollywood star Katrina Kaif, celebrated for her dynamic on-screen presence, recently opened up about her life as a Punjabi daughter-in-law. Katrina and Vicky Kaushal got married in a grand ceremony in December 2021. The actress engaged with her fans in an interactive ‘Ask Me Anything’ session on Instagram. During this session, she shared insights into her personal life post-marriage, capturing the interest of her followers.

Embracing Punjabi Traditions

When asked about her favourite aspect of being part of a Punjabi family. Katrina’s response highlighted her love for the warmth and affection inherent in Punjabi culture. She expressed her fondness for homemade Punjabi cuisine, particularly ‘sarso da saag’ and ‘makki ki roti’. She even shared a snapshot of the delightful dish.

Insights from “Merry Christmas”

Katrina also delved into her professional world, discussing her latest film, “Merry Christmas.” The movie has been receiving accolades from both audiences and critics. She also addressed a question about mastering Tamil dialogues for the movie. The diva acknowledged the challenge but was grateful for the constant support from co-star Vijay Sethupathi.

An endearing moment from Katrina’s AMA was her sharing a photo of Vicky Kaushal embracing her tightly after watching “Merry Christmas,” in response to a fan’s query about the best reaction she received to the film.

The Storyline of “Merry Christmas”

“Merry Christmas” is set against the backdrop of Christmas Eve, unravelling the intriguing life of Maria (played by Katrina), a single mother, and her mute daughter Annie (portrayed by Pari Sharma). Their encounter with Albert (Vijay Sethupathi), an architect returning from Dubai, leads to a series of unexpected revelations.

The film, unique for being shot in two languages, features distinct supporting casts for its Hindi and Tamil versions. The Hindi adaptation includes notable performances by Sanjay Kapoor, Vinay Pathak, Pratima Kannan, and Tinnu Anand, while the Tamil version stars Radhika Sarathkumar, Shanmugaraja, Kevin Jay Babu, and Rajesh Williams in parallel roles.
